The finned tube is to improve the heat exchange efficiency, usually by adding fins on the surface of the heat exchange tube to increase the external surface area (or internal surface area) of the heat exchange tube, so as to achieve the purpose of improving the heat exchange efficiency, such a change Heat pipe.

Welded Stainless Steel Tube for Heat Exchanger Boilers
classification
1. Divided by fin structure characteristics

According to the shape and structure of the fin, the finned tube can be divided into the following types: square finned tube, spiral finned tube, longitudinal finned tube, etc., spiral serrated Finned tubes (Helical Serrated Finned Tubes), inner finned tubes (inner finned tube) ,

2. According to whether the fin material of the finned tube is the same as the material of the tube body, it can be divided into a single metal finned tube and a bimetallic composite finned tube.

3. According to different processing techniques of finned tubes, finned tubes can be divided into: rolled finned tubes (extruded fin tubes), welded and formed finned tubes, roll-formed finned tubes, and packaged finned tubes.

Main performance requirements
As a heat exchange element, finned tubes work for a long period of time under high-temperature flue gas conditions. For example, the finned tubes for boiler heat exchangers have a harsh environment, high temperature and high pressure, and are in a corrosive atmosphere. This requires finned tubes to have high performance index.

1) Anti-corrosion performance (Anti-corrosion)

2) Anti-wear performance

3) Low contact resistance (lower contact resistance)

4) High stability (Higher Stability)

5) Anti-ashing ability



At present, the three-roller cross-rolled integral spiral finned tube technology has been successfully applied to single-finned tubes or composite finned tubes with copper and aluminum fins, or steel low-finned tubes; steel integral finned tubes are currently available Low-fin tubes are more common in the market, and integral high-fin tubes are mostly made of aluminum, copper, etc., and are generally cold rolled.  In view of the high frequency welding finned tube and non-ferrous metal integrally rolled finned tube on the market, it is easier to find, and the integrally rolled finned tube (steel) has fewer finned tubes.
